YNYSMEUDWY LOCKS WORK PARTY: 22.5.18.
Our friends from the Waterway Recovery Group willbe joining us in August to start on giving the two locks at Ynysmeudwy a much needed
facelift. In preparation for this Michelle organised a work party at both locks to clear the ramapant vegetation. Above are the pictures of the Lower Lock by wash before and after the work.
